09/02/2009 Andrew Bond from UK

"Visited for 3 days in Feb 2009. Fab little resort. Can easily see why it is particularly recommended for families - I have no children and generally avoid them where possible but can equally see that the facilities on offer here are better than average. Stayed in the Snowbird Lodge - v high quality accommodation & genuinely ski in/out: cooker/fridge/dishwasher/sinks in appartment for self-catering with small area with dining table for eating if we had taken that option. Trouble was there were 4 bars/restaurants in the village which each had different styles offering apres ski deals or straight forward drinks/meal menus. All well worth visiting. The slopes seemed to be more extensive than the limited acreage suggests - possibly due to the different feel to each of the ski areas. Intermediates will feel that they have travelled around a larger area. On mountain dining is limited - Paradise Camp below the top of Powder Gulch lift is the only option other than returning to the village but gives a good service of basic bulk over quality cooking with booze available if needed. Intermediates or above will become bored after 3 days - I would recommend trying this place as part of a twin centre holiday or a ski safari."

23/03/2008 Dave & Joyce from Aberdeen

"A picturesque small village setting directly on the slopes, with friendly coffee shops, bars, and general store. Snowbird Lodge has hig quality apartment accommodation with ski store exiting onto the slope. Good option for families and/or as part of a two location holiday. "
